possibly unforeseen effects A confused B puzzled C disturbed D troubled 阅读理解 A A Jackie Heinricher s love affair with bamboo started in her backyard As a child I remember playing among the golden bamboo my dad had planted and when there was a slight wind the bamboos sounded really musical A fisheries biologist Heinricher 47 planned to work in the salmon industry in Seattle where she lived with her husband Guy Thornburgh but she found it too competitive Then her garden gave her the idea for a business She d planted 20 bamboo forests on their 用心 爱心 专心2 seven acre farm Heinricher started Boo Shoot Gardens in 1998 She realized early on what is just now beginning to be known to the rest of the world It can be used to make fishing poles skateboards buildings furniture floors and even clothing An added bonus Bamboo absorbs four times as much carbon dioxide as a group of hardwood trees and releases 35 percent more oxygen First she had to find a way to mass produce the plants a tough task since bamboo flowers create seed only once every 50 to 100 years And dividing a bamboo plant frequently kills it Heinricher appealed to Randy Burr a tissue culture expert to help her People kept telling us we d never figure it out says Heinricher Others had worked on it for 27 years I believed in what we were doing though so I just kept going She was right to feel a sense of urgency Bamboo forests are being rapidly used up and a United Nations report showed that even though bamboo is highly renewable as many as half of the world s species are threatened with dying out Heinricher knew that bamboo could make a significant impact on carbon emissions 排放 and world economies but only if huge numbers could be produced And that s just what she and Burr figured out after nine years of experiments a way to grow millions of plants By placing cuttings in test tubes with salts vitamins plant hormones and seaweed gel they got the plants to grow and then raised them in soil in greenhouses Not long after it Burr s lab hit financial difficulties Heinricher had no experience running a tissue culture operation but she wasn t prepared to quit So she bought the lab Today Heinricher heads up a profitable multimillion dollar company working on species from all over the world and selling them to wholesalers 批发商 If you want to farm bamboo it s hard to do without the young plants and that s what we have she says proudly 11 What was the main problem with planting bamboo widely A They didn t have enough young bamboo B They were short of money and experience C They didn t
